I have 2 15 inch kicker l7 @4 ohms each sub has its own amp us amps md1d 750 watts @ 2 ohms im trying to find out if i can make the subs play at a lower ohm such as 1 ohm without hurting them or is there any other way to get the most out of them i have the amps strap together. Thanks for all the help mrcrown89
August 15, 200916 yr So each sub has dual 4 ohm coils? If so you can't wire an individual speaker down to 1 ohm, only 2.If you want more power you mismatched your amps to your subs. You'd have to get a different amplifier(s). But aren't those subs 750 watts RMS anyways? Adding more power won't do much for you.
